French Bob With Bangs

A French bob with bangs delivers effortless Parisian chic in a compact, low-maintenance package. Sitting at or slightly above the jawline, this cut pairs a blunt or softly rounded edge with light, wispy fringe that barely skims the eyebrows.

The mostly one-length construction with very subtle layering keeps the shape clean, while airy bangs move easily without overwhelming your face. This style is especially flattering on oval, square, and heart-shaped faces.

Blow-dry with a medium round brush, rolling ends under and directing bangs forward, then finish with a light texturizing spray. The result is soft bounce that feels effortless yet always appears perfectly neat and intentional.

Inverted Bob Short Haircut

If you appreciate a polished, slightly dramatic shape with more length framing the front, the inverted bob creates a beautiful sweeping line when viewed from any angle. The back is cut shorter and stacked, while the front pieces angle down toward or just below the chin.

Well-defined graduation at the back and a smooth curved outline create a sculpted appearance rather than a choppy one. This style flatters round, square, and fuller face shapes by elongating the front profile beautifully.

Blow-dry the back with a round brush for crown lift and smooth the front sections forward with a slight inward curve. Finish with a shine spray to emphasize the clean angles for maximum polished impact.

Textured Pixie Cut For Fine Hair

Fine hair transforms dramatically with this cleverly designed pixie that creates the illusion of thickness while maintaining a neat, refined silhouette. Short, tidy sides and back frame choppy, piecey layers on top that add dimension and lift.

Subtle point-cutting on the ends combined with layers at varying lengths across the crown maximizes movement without making the shape appear messy. This style works especially well on straight or slightly wavy fine hair.

Sprinkle texturizing powder at the roots or work in a light styling paste, then lift and pinch sections with your fingers. The result is soft, polished volume that holds beautifully throughout even the longest day.

Short Layered Bob For Thick Hair

Thick hair needs a strategic cut that removes excess bulk while preserving its gorgeous natural density. This short layered bob sits between the cheekbones and jawline with invisible internal layers that help the hair move freely instead of forming a solid block.

Slide cutting through the mid-lengths and ends keeps the silhouette tailored but lighter, while gentle graduation at the back adds lift at the crown. The result is a polished outline that feels manageable rather than overwhelming.

Style with smoothing cream and a round brush, lifting slightly at roots and turning ends under or outward. Add a tiny amount of oil to the tips for softness and shine that makes thick hair look its absolute best.

Short Haircut With Finger Waves

Finger waves bring vintage glamour to cropped hair with sculpted S-shaped curves that follow the contours of your head. This polished, art-deco-inspired look feels remarkably modern on short hair and makes an unforgettable statement at formal events.

Created using a comb, setting lotion, and clips, the waves are molded while the hair sets into perfectly defined ridges. This technique works beautifully on relaxed, straightened, or naturally wavy textures for a striking sculptural effect.

Maintain the polished look by sleeping with a satin scarf and refreshing with setting foam between appointments. This is the kind of hairstyle that transforms your short cut into wearable art for special occasions.

Blunt Bob For Straight Hair

A blunt bob delivers sleek, minimal sophistication with all ends cut to one precise length around the chin or jawline. This creates an instantly sharp outline that flatters most face shapes, especially oval and heart.

The precise perimeter with optional light internal layering for thick hair keeps the shape smooth rather than bulky. A slight undercut underneath can help extremely thick hair lie flat without adding visible layers to the exterior.

Blow-dry with a paddle brush pulling hair straight down, run a flat iron over small sections, and finish with a shine serum. The result is a mirror-like, glossy bob that looks expensive and effortlessly chic.
